Furry friend

As I announced on Facebook, this blog is about the newest addition to my phone.
Rabito, inspired by everyone's favourite pet.


Besides the fact that it is the cutest, and probably the coolest, phone case I have seen so far it is also very functional.
The detachable furry tail can be use as a phone stand or just to look cute, the ears are perfect to wind your ears phones around. They will no longer be tangled or get lost!

The designer of this furry friend is Mina Kwag from Korea. She quit her job at Samsung a couple years ago to become a designer and with only one prototype of the Rabito (also called iPoda) and a few other accessory designs she went to a comtemporary design show in London. From that day on her phone was ringing off the hook.
She started her own company in 2010 and now delivers her products to over 15 countries.




As Mina describes, Rabito is the perfect accessory for our most essential device.
And it's a pretty damn cute one too!

Tape it

Washi tape, or also know as masking tape, might be the biggest hype in DIY land at the moment.
The idea is actually quite simple: it's a tape made of rice paper, in a fun color or print. Because of the material it is easy to tear, easy to remove, you are able to use it multiple times and you can easily write on it.

So it's a cute looking tape. But what do you do with it?
Lemme show ya...


Tune up your dull keyboard into something colorful and fun




Make pretty labels! You can use them for gift wrapping, labelling your cookie or candy jars...



Super easy to make and so much fun as a cupcake topper or as decoration in a drink



Empty bottles or old vases become funky in a flash



Block time slots in your schedule



A temporary collage on the wall



Even phones and mp3 players aren't safe anymore
